Abstract
Action planning by intelligent agents in open dynamic multi-agent worlds is a challenging problem when creating autonomous robots, UAVs and other autonomous systems. A method for planning actions in an ever-changing multi-agent world is proposed, that ensures the effective use of the deliberation time by planning mental actions. Knowledge representation models necessary for the agent to implement advanced iterative planning are considered. The proposed approach is illustrated by examples of planning an agent’s actions in virtual soccer.
